Who we work with

Built for files that don't fit the bank box.

Private mortgage options exist for borrowers who fall outside standard bank guidelines — often for reasons that have nothing to do with their ability to actually repay.

📉

Bad or bruised credit

Collections, missed payments, consumer proposals, past bankruptcy, or a score that doesn't reflect where you are today. Private lenders focus on equity first.

No minimum score
📋

Self-employed income

If you write off expenses, your taxable income on paper may not reflect what you actually earn. We work with lenders who understand how to read a self-employed file.

Stated income options
⏱️

Urgent timeline

Closing in days, renewal falling through, a possession deadline, or a power of sale notice. Private lenders can move significantly faster when the file is clear.

48–72hr closings possible
🏦

Mortgage arrears & CRA debt

Behind on payments or carrying a CRA lien? A private mortgage can sometimes stop the clock and buy time to stabilize before a bank exit is possible.

Foreclosure situations welcome
💳

Debt consolidation

High-interest credit cards, personal loans, or CRA balances can sometimes be consolidated into a single mortgage-secured payment, reducing monthly pressure.

Single monthly payment
🏠

Second mortgages

Already have a mortgage you don't want to break? A second mortgage lets you access equity without disrupting your existing rate or triggering a penalty.

Keep your first mortgage

Illustrative examples

What private mortgage files look like.

Examples only. All financing subject to qualification, property assessment, lender approval, and individual file details. Results vary.

$110K 2nd Mtg

Mortgage arrears + creditor pressure

Homeowner used available equity to resolve missed payments and a creditor judgment before power of sale was triggered.

Edmonton area Closed in 9 days
$292K Refinance

Self-employed debt consolidation

Business owner with strong cash flow but limited taxable income consolidated high-interest debt into a single mortgage payment.

Calgary area Closed in 14 days
$385K Private 1st

Bank declined, non-standard file

Borrower with prior consumer proposal and non-standard income secured a private first mortgage. B-lender exit planned at 18 months.

St. Albert Closed in 18 days
$215K Bridge

Purchase & sale timing gap

Short-term financing bridged a 6-week gap between a new purchase closing and proceeds from the existing home sale clearing.

Leduc area Closed in 6 days
